Variable annuities are a kind of investment income stream that climbs or drops in worth occasionally based on the marketplace efficiency of the investments that fund the earnings. A capitalist who selects to produce an annuity may select either a variable annuity or a taken care of annuity. An annuity is an economic product offered by an insurance policy company and offered through banks.

Annuities are most typically utilized to produce a normal stream of retired life revenue. The fixed annuity is an alternative to the variable annuity. A set annuity develops the amount of the payment ahead of time. The worth of variable annuities is based upon the efficiency of a hidden portfolio of sub-accounts picked by the annuity owner.

Set annuities provide a guaranteed return. Variable annuities provide the opportunity of higher returns but also the danger that the account will certainly fall in worth. A variable annuity is produced by a contract contract made by an investor and an insurance provider. The investor makes a round figure settlement or a series of payments gradually to fund the annuity, which will certainly start paying at a future date.

The repayments can continue for the life of the capitalist or for the life of the financier or the financier's surviving spouse. It likewise can be paid out in a set number of payments. One of the various other significant decisions is whether to organize for a variable annuity or a repaired annuity, which sets the quantity of the payment ahead of time.

Sub-accounts are structured like common funds, although they do not have ticker icons that investors can easily use to track their accounts. Two elements add to the payment amounts in a variable annuity: the principal, which is the amount of cash the capitalist pays in advancement, and the returns that the annuity's underlying financial investments deliver on that principal in time.

Variable annuities have higher potential for incomes growth yet they can also lose money. Fixed annuities usually pay out at a lower but steady rate compared to variable annuities.

No, annuities are not guaranteed by the Federal Down Payment Insurance Coverage Corp. (FDIC) as they are not financial institution products. They are secured by state guaranty associations if the insurance policy business giving the item goes out of organization. Before acquiring a variable annuity, investors ought to carefully review the syllabus to comprehend the costs, risks, and solutions for determining investment gains or losses.

Bear in mind that in between the many feessuch as investment management fees, mortality costs, and management feesand costs for any added motorcyclists, a variable annuity's expenditures can swiftly build up. That can detrimentally impact your returns over the long term, compared to other sorts of retired life investments.

That relies on the performance of your investments. Some variable annuities offer choices, known as cyclists, that enable steady payments, instead than those that change with the marketwhich appears a whole lot like a taken care of annuity. The variable annuity's underlying account balance still transforms with market efficiency, potentially influencing exactly how long your payments will last.

There are 2 major sorts of annuities: fixed and variable. The major distinction between them is the amount of threat thought to achieve your wanted price of return. Variable annuities will lug even more threat, while taken care of annuities generally offer competitive rates of interest and restricted threat. A deferred annuity enables you to make a round figure payment or a number of settlements with time to your insurance provider to offer income after a set period. This period enables the rate of interest on your annuity to expand tax-free before you can collect payments. Deferred annuities are commonly held for around twenty years prior to being qualified to get settlements.
